摘要:

分别从射频识别天线、可穿戴/可植入天线、多物理量传感天线、能量收集天线、基于先进材料及工艺的片上封装天线等角度,系统介绍了目前物联网中的天线技术研究进展。进而结合近年在天线领域科研和教学实践,提出基于“单腔多模”思想、面向物联网应用的多谐天线设计理论,最后列举基于该理论的若干应用实例。

Abstract:

From the perspectives of RFID antennas, wearable/implantable antennas, multi-physical sensing antennas, energy harvesting antennas, and on-chip package antennas based on advanced materials and processes, the current research progress of antenna technology for internet of things was introduced. Combined with the research and teaching practice in the field of antennas in recent years, the multi-harmonic antenna design theory based on the “single-cavity multi-mode” idea and the application of the internet of things were proposed. Finally, several application examples based on this theory were listed.
